Smothered Chicken Wings Baked

5 Stars 4 Stars 3 Stars 2 Stars 1 Star

No reviews

🍗 This Smothered Chicken Wings Recipe offers rich and savory flavors with tender wings bathed in a creamy, flavorful gravy.
🔥 It’s a comforting dish perfect for hearty family dinners or special gatherings, bringing bold taste and satisfying texture.

  • Total Time: 1 hour 15 minutes
  • Yield: 4 servings

Ingredients

– 2 pounds chicken wings (split party wings or whole wings)

– 1 teaspoon smoked paprika

– 1 teaspoon garlic powder

– Salt and pepper to taste

– 1 cup sliced or chopped white onions

– ½ cup chopped green peppers

– 1 cup chicken broth

– 2 tablespoons unsalted butter

– 1 tablespoon olive oil

– ¼ cup all-purpose flour

– ½ cup heavy whipping cream or half and half

– Additional garlic powder for gravy, amount to taste

Instructions

1-Place 1 cup sliced or chopped white onions and ½ cup chopped green peppers at the bottom of a 9×13 baking dish.

2-Lay the seasoned wings over the onions and peppers.

3-Drizzle 1 cup chicken broth into the dish along the edges.

4-Cover the dish with foil and bake for 45 minutes.

5-Remove the foil, take the wings out, and set them aside. Keep the drippings, broth, peppers, and onions for the gravy.

6-In a saucepan over medium-high heat, melt 2 tablespoons unsalted butter and 1 tablespoon olive oil.

7-Add the onions and sauté for 3-4 minutes until they’re translucent and fragrant.

8-Gradually stir in ¼ cup all-purpose flour to avoid clumping.

9-Add ½ cup heavy whipping cream or half and half, the reserved drippings, chicken broth, and a bit more garlic powder.

10-Stir continuously until the sauce thickens, then return the wings to the pan with the gravy.

11-Bake uncovered for an additional 15-25 minutes, until the chicken hits 165 degrees Fahrenheit inside.

Notes

🍖 Split party wings cook more evenly than whole wings.
🌶️ Season wings to your taste with smoked paprika, garlic powder, and your favorite rub.
🥄 For thinner gravy, substitute some heavy cream with milk or half and half.
❄️ Store leftovers refrigerated for 3-4 days or freeze for up to 3 months.
🌡️ Always use a meat thermometer to ensure wings reach safe internal temperature.
